
The glacial lakes of Steuben County dominate this landscape, where Lake James and Snow Lake create a complex network of peninsulas and points. Angola serves as the regional anchor in the southeast, characterized by its academic center at Trine University and the prominent Old Circle Hill Cem. This corner of Indiana is defined by its water-dependent settlements and summer colonies like Point Comfort, Spring Point, and Glen Eden.
